  • Patent number: 4138438
    Abstract: An improvement is disclosed in the preparation of pentachloronitrobenzene by the reaction of pentachlorobenzene with mixed nitration acid. The improvement, which is aimed at reducing undesirable impurities in the product, includes the use of a selected process step, wherein excess, unreacted nitric acid is reacted with HCl.

  • Patent number: 3965183
    Abstract: p-Fluoro-m-phenylenediamine is prepared by deoxygenation and hydrofluorination of m-nitroacetanilide by the reaction of m-nitroacetanilide with anhydrous hydrogen fluoride at a temperature of 0.degree.-230.degree.C under a pressure of 15 to 1,500 psia in the presence of certain sulfur and phosphorus containing deoxygenating agents.

  • Patent number: 3950444
    Abstract: A process is provided for preparing ortho substituted aryl fluorides from corresponding diazonium fluorides. More particularly, the invention relates to a method for thermally decomposing diazonium fluorides substituted in the ortho position with halogen or trihalomethyl to a corresponding aryl fluoride. The method involves heating the diazonium fluoride to a temperature above its decomposition temperature and above the temperature at which the resulting product distills by contacting the same with a heat exchange medium at a temperature in the range of 100.degree.-350.degree.C.
